About Our Cattery Near Bury St Edmunds

Old School Cattery is a small, family-run cattery set in the garden of a 16th century thatched cottage in Whepstead, in the heart of the Suffolk countryside just a few miles from Bury St Edmunds. It is owned and operated by Pamela and Oli, who live on site - so there is always someone here to care for your cat and security is excellent.

A qualified animal behaviourist

Pamela is a qualified animal behaviourist and studied animal behaviour in 2004 with the Open College Network provided by COAPE (the Centre of Applied Pet Ethology). She has loved and lived with cats all her life and is passionate not only about their everyday well-being but their emotional needs too. Having worked in animal rescue, Pamela has encountered a wide range of personalities and behavioural quirks, and understands how to provide a calm home from home for even the most nervous and timid cats.

Small numbers, genuine one-to-one care

We deliberately take on only a small number of cats at any one time, because we would rather provide a high quality, one-to-one service than run a busy cattery. Cats are intelligent, sensitive creatures that need a loving, warm and safe environment as well as plenty of mental stimulation, which is why toys, games and enrichment are part of every stay. Calming Feliway and crystals help newcomers feel settled and at ease.

A peaceful rural setting

Our purpose-built guest rooms are larger than average, double glazed, centrally heated and insulated, with multiple levels, large windows and a separate covered toilet area. Cats cannot see other cats in adjacent rooms, and units are only ever shared by cats from the same family. With a window looking out onto the garden and chickens, it is a quiet, peaceful place for your cat to relax.

Fully licensed and inspected

Old School Cattery is fully licensed by West Suffolk Council, annually inspected by Environmental Health, fully insured and fire-safety inspected, so you can relax knowing your cat is in safe, professional hands.
